Basic Restorations were added into Car Town in December 2011. The Restorations were a complete sucess from the begining and Car Town has been adding restorations in it ever since.

Restoration Car ListEdit


  • When the Junkyard was realased for the first time, there weren`t any Master Mechanic Restorations. 
  • At the beggining of the Junkyard, you couldn` choose the car you wanted to restore out of a complete list. You had to choose between 4 different cars that changed daily.
  • When a player completes 10 Cars, they unlock Master Mechanic.

Ad blocker interference detected!

Wikia is a free-to-use site that makes money from advertising. We have a modified experience for viewers using ad blockers

Wikia is not accessible if you’ve made further modifications. Remove the custom ad blocker rule(s) and the page will load as expected.